Ingredients
| Quantity | Ingredient | 
|---|---|
| 1 | Carrots | 
| 2 tbsp | Olive Oil | 
| 1/4 tsp | Salt | 
| 1/4 tsp | Black Pepper | 
| 1 tbsp | Honey | 
| 1/2 tsp | Ground Cinnamon | 
Instructions
- 
Prepare the Carrots: - Begin by washing and peeling the carrots. Cut them into thin slices or sticks, whichever you prefer for your dish.
 
- 
Steam the Carrots: - Place the sliced carrots in a microwave-safe dish with a few teaspoons of water.
- Microwave on high for 3-5 minutes, or until the carrots are tender yet still crisp. Be sure to cover the dish to create steam.
 
- 
Prepare the Flavorful Blend: - In a mixing bowl or serving bowl, combine the olive oil, salt, black pepper, honey, and ground cinnamon. π₯ Mix everything together until well combined.
 
- 
Combine and Toss: - Once the carrots are steamed, add them to the bowl with the flavorful blend.
- Gently toss the carrots with the mixture, ensuring each piece is coated evenly. The warm carrots will absorb the delicious flavors!
 
- 
Serve and Enjoy: - Transfer the Easy Moroccan Carrots to a serving dish.
- Garnish with a sprinkle of fresh herbs like parsley or cilantro for an extra pop of color and flavor.
- These carrots are fantastic served warm as a side dish alongside your favorite main course. They also make a tasty and healthy snack on their own!
 
- 
Tip for Indian Twist: - For those who love Indian flavors, here’s a quick variation! Instead of black pepper and cinnamon, try using 1/2 to 1 teaspoon of garam masala. This aromatic spice blend will add a whole new dimension to your Moroccan-inspired carrots!

Recipe Notes π
- 
These Easy Moroccan Carrots are incredibly versatile! Feel free to adjust the seasonings to suit your taste preferences. You can add more honey for extra sweetness or a pinch of cayenne pepper for a spicy kick. 
- 
To make this dish even quicker, you can use baby carrots or pre-cut carrot sticks. Just adjust the steaming time accordingly. 
- 
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. They are delicious cold or gently reheated in the microwave. 
- 
Serve these carrots alongside grilled chicken, roasted meats, or as a flavorful addition to a vegetarian Buddha bowl. They also make a lovely topping for salads or wraps!
